SUMMARY
Are you a newly graduated electrical engineering student looking to GROW your career?
Graduate Rotational Opportunities at Westlake (GROW) is a leadership development program for newly graduated engineering students within the Performance and Essential Materials business segment at Westlake Corporation.
The GROW program is a 3 - 5 year rotational program that offers the chance to explore various aspects of the Westlake business. You will gain invaluable on-the-job experience, receive leadership and technical training, and work on exciting projects. If you are looking for an opportunity where you can demonstrate your ingenuity by solving real world problems, in an environment focused on enhancing our lives every day, we encourage you to apply for the GROW program.
During your time in the program, you can expect to rotate through different roles, such as:
Operations
Reliability
Capital Projects
Continuous Improvement
Process Controls
Business Management
Supply Chain & Logistics

Once you complete the program, exciting post program opportunities await you. You could become a: Process Engineer, Production Engineer, Maintenance Engineer, Reliability Engineer, Electrical Engineer, Instrumentation Engineer, Continuous Improvement Engineer, or Project Engineer.
EDUCATION, EXPERIENCE AND QUALIFICATIONS
B.S. or M.S. degree in Electrical Engineering
0-2 years of relevant work experience
Minimum 3.0 GPA
Willing to rotate to different US locations every 12-18 months for a total of 3 - 5 years
Ability and willingness to obtain a Transportation Worker’s Identification Card (TWIC)
Strong team building, leadership and problem-solving skills
Strong communication skills
